Grounds for election
Murray Andrews is a Post-Excavation Project Officer with Headland Archaeology, having extensive experience of working as a finds specialist and teaching archaeology at UCL and the University of Worcester. He has transformed the study of medieval coin hoards in England and Wales with his published Institute of Archaeology UCL PhD thesis on Coin hoards and society in medieval England and Wales, AD c.973-1544 (2019) and numerous other publications, bringing to it a new depth of archaeological analysis. This built upon his MA thesis on Coin use and circulation in the medieval West Midlands, c.1066-1544 (2013) and his work on Romano-British archaeology. His work has been recognized with the Philip Rahtz Prize of the Society for Medieval Archaeology. He is the Editor of the Worcestershire Recorder, and a Committee Member of the Worcestershire Archaeological Society and the British Academy Sylloge of Coins of the British Isles and Medieval European Coinage projects.
